- ; BLOCK.CMD: Rectangualar Cut/Paste macros
-
- ; delete a rectangular block of text
-
- store-procedure getblock
- ;set up needed variables
- set $discmd FALSE
- delete-buffer "[block]"
- set %rcbuf $cbufname
- set %cline $cwline
-
- ;save block boundries
- set %endpos $curcol
- set %endline $curline
- exchange-point-and-mark
- set %begpos $curcol
- set %begline $curline
- set %blwidth &sub %endpos %begpos
-
- ;detab the region
- &add &sub %endline %begline 1 detab-line
-
- ;scan through the block
- set $curline %begline
- !while &less $curline &add %endline 1
- ;grab the part of this line needed
- !force set $curcol %begpos
- set-mark
- !force set $curcol %endpos
- kill-region
-
- ;bring it back if this is just a copy
- !if %bkcopy
- yank
- !endif
-
- ;put the line in the block buffer
- select-buffer "[block]"
- yank
-
- ;and pad it if needed
- !if &less $curcol %blwidth
- &sub %blwidth $curcol insert-space
- end-of-line
- !endif
- forward-character
-
- ;onward...
- select-buffer %rcbuf
- next-line
- !endwhile
-
- ;unmark the block
- select-buffer "[block]"
- unmark-buffer
- select-buffer %rcbuf
- previous-line
- %cline redraw-display
- set $discmd TRUE
- !endm
-
- ; insert/overlay a rectangular block of text
-
- store-procedure putblock
- ;set up needed variables
- set $discmd FALSE
- set %rcbuf $cbufname
- set %cline $cwline
-
- ;save block boundries
- set %begpos $curcol
- set %begline $curline
-
- ;scan through the block
- select-buffer "[block]"
- beginning-of-file
- set %endpos &add %begpos $lwidth
- !while ¬ &equ $lwidth 0
-
- ;pad the destination if it is needed
- select-buffer %rcbuf
- beginning-of-line
- !if ¬ &equ $lwidth 0
- detab-line
- previous-line
- !endif
- !force set $curcol %begpos
- !if &less $curcol %begpos
- &sub %begpos $curcol insert-space
- end-of-line
- !endif
-
- ;delete some stuff if this should overlay
- !if %bkcopy
- set-mark
- !force set $curcol %endpos
- kill-region
- !endif
-
- ;grab the line from the block buffer
- select-buffer "[block]"
- beginning-of-line
- set-mark
- end-of-line
- copy-region
- forward-character
-
- ;put the line in the destination position
- select-buffer %rcbuf
- yank
- next-line
-
- ;onward...
- select-buffer "[block]"
- !endwhile
-
- select-buffer %rcbuf
- set $curline %begline
- set $curcol %begpos
- %cline redraw-display
- set $discmd TRUE
- !endm
